Gunsmith: The Junk Gun and The Absorb Sword

Blaze got up and stretched. He saw that Crowley set up a gunsmith challenge, so he was happy to oblige. He went back to his work table, and took out his grappling hook. After taking it apart and laying it out, Blaze got an idea of how he could make a nice sniper rifle. He grabbed some of his steel scrap, and started bending it out. After a few hours, Blaze had set up a pretty........ well, it wasn’t pretty, but after landing his ship and testing it, it worked very well. He was glad he saw Crowley’s daughter enough to engrave a surprisingly nice mandalorian helmet into the stock. After returning to his ship, he realized how..... simple the gun was. It worked, it was ugly, but it wasn’t unique. He thought for a moment, before realizing a perfect addition. Onto the clip, he started adding a small funnel that could accept elemental energy, and funnel it into the bullets. It was simple. All of the titanium rounds were hollow, sacrificing some damage, but allowed elemental energy, or any energy really, to be funneled into it. Then, after testing again with his own power, Blaze inspected the bullseye, and saw it pulsing with electricity. Afterwards, he attached a simple 4-10-20x scope, and took a look at what he made. He bent it into shape a bit more, making it fit snug against a shoulder, and keeping every vital part in check, with only a few jagged edges, but snipers could always use more melee capability. It was ready to send to be judged, not much else he could do, besides hope his junk gun could win. A few hours after sending in his entry, Blaze got it sent back, with a note saying he needed to make a sword. Of course, he saw that announcement, and saw a note was sent in by Sylver. If he had a chance before, it went up in smoke. Luckily, Blaze just wanted to have fun making the weapon. He found some extra titanium scrap, and started forging it into a blade, melting it using the fire of his ships engine. He used a absorbent form of titanium, to do what he did before with the gun. He set up tiny pipes going up from a funnel in the hilt, with a few holes leading onto the sword, letting it accept what you input. He was happy this sword didn’t need to be hollow. A bullet being hollow is a bit less of a deal then a sword. Right above the hilt, he engraved the same mandalorian helmet. He went outside to test it. It felt right, or at least he thought it would, he wasn’t used to this type of weapon. He slashed, and in the middle of the slash, he squeezed the hilt.. The moment he did, a sizeable lightning bolt was let loose. So, it’s good that it worked. He added a small pressure detector under the hilt. He modified it a bit, to make sure it didn’t just expel the energy at any old squeeze. He slashed a few times. The grip, made of the same titanium, except hollow and covered in a bit of comfortable rubber. It was a happy mix of classic weaponry, magic, and tech. Even if it didn’t win, he was happy with it.
